Output 6da89f286159fa21be40c103be9df85e8eee9d23dae32e878c6cd5c88d419efd:0

value
1640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ffabbc59aa8e1df4fdf2a8eefd70c6efe909488e OP_EQUAL
address
3QzsxsN2nxffeHzj7x7Wm2s5vnTznyma2z
transaction
6da89f286159fa21be40c103be9df85e8eee9d23dae32e878c6cd5c88d419efd
spent
true